Merci Merci:  2
Likes Likes:  0
Dislikes Dislikes:  0
Affiche les résultats de 1 à 5 sur 5

Sujet : Tuto pour installer cron sur image Marrwensat ou autre en E1


  1. #1
    DZSatien Motivé Avatar de costa69
    Inscrit
    Aug 2010
    Lieu
    france
    Âge
    39
    Messages
    466
    Récepteur
    dreambox
    TV
    condor
    Remerciement / J'aime

    Tuto pour installer cron sur image Marrwensat ou autre en E1

    Salut a tous apres des heure de recherche et de modif je vous fais un tuto pour avoir le cron sur Image marwensat ( tester sur marwensat,nemsis )


    Le cron sert a lancer des tache comme surveiller Oscam ou CCcam ou encore faire un reboot tous les jours a une heure bien precis ou juste restarté votre emu


    le cron peux faire different tache le tous est de lancer le bon script pour se que on veux faire


    ici je vais vous expliqué comment installer et lancer le crond par exemple pour update key tous les 1 minutes mais je peux tres bien me servire du cron pour plusieur tache en meme temps


    sur beaucoups d image, sur E1 le crond existe pas.


    tous d'abord allez sur /var/etc et envoyer le fichier qui se nome crond_startup.sh attribut 755


    une fois fais redémarrer votre dreambox


    faite 1 fois bouton bleu puis allez sur Start-Stop programs et vous allez trouvez Enable Crond faite la touche OK dessu


    une fois fais vous allez sur /var/spool et normalement vous allez avoir des fichier cron puis crontabs si il existe pas cree les (attribut 755).




    une fois dans crontabs cree un fichier root en attribut 755


    et c dans se fichier root qui faux mettre les commande pour excuté une tache ceci se compose comme ceci
    voir cette exemple
    ############################################
    # crontab format #
    # For use with Punt@l Image CronManager #
    # If you edit by FTP, keep blank spaces at #
    # end of the cronjob lines #
    ############################################
    # +---------minute 00-59
    # | +-------hour 00-23
    # | | +-----day of month 00-31
    # | | | +---month 00-12
    # | | | | +-day of week 1-7 (7 is Sun)
    # | | | | |
    # * * * * * command
    * 23 31 * * Bitstream_userscript.sh


    donc si je veux lancer Oscam_KeyUpdate.sh toutes les minute je met ca dans dans le fichier root
    */1 * * * * /var/script/Oscam_KeyUpdate.sh &


    cela veux dire crond va executé la tache toutes les minutes et tous les jours


    une fois */1 * * * * /var/script/Oscam_KeyUpdate.sh & mis dans le fichier root


    allez sur /var/script et mettre le fichier qui se nome Oscam_KeyUpdate.sh attribut 755


    une fois fais redemarer votre dreambox et vous allez voir si votre cron et bien configuré
    dans l exemple le cron va telecharger le fichier key qui se trouve dans /var/keys
    oscam.key et un autre dans var/tuxbox/config oscam.key si vous affacer le fichier key vous allez voir que le cron va le relancer dans la minutes suivantes et il sera a nouveau present le fichier oscam.key ceci veux dire que le cron fonctionne comme il le faux


    tous les tache que vous allez faire et les script que vous allez mettre dans var/script il dois etre renomé en .sh et attribu 755


    si vous faite bouton bleu 1 fois puis system info puis show active process vous devez voir le cron dans la liste


    je vous met les fichier et dautre script comme pour surveiller oscam ou cccam , le tous est que sur le script de surveillance et bien noté par le nom que votre binaire as


    #! /bin/sh
    if ps | grep -v grep | grep -c oscam >/dev/null
    then
    echo "oscam is OK"
    else
    echo "oscam VIRKER IKKJE"
    echo "Restarting oscam"
    /var/bin/oscam
    fi


    donc dans cette exemple mon binaire se nome oscam si dans /var/bin javais oscam_1.20 alors sur le script je met oscam_1.20 o lieu de oscam on peux faire pareil pour Cccam ou mgcamd
    attention au majuscule noté le de la meme facon
    le script de surveillence si je le nome emustarter.sh dans /var/script
    alors je met ca dans le fichier var/spool/cron/crontabs/root


    */1 * * * * /var/script/emustarter.sh & ( surveille et relance toutes les 1 minutes))))))))))))))))))


    */10 * * * * /var/script/emustarter.sh & ( surveille est relance toutes les 10 minutes )


    tous c fichier seront joint

    ne me dites pas que vous ne y arrivez pas

    jai tester les script que je vous poste elle fonctionne toutes


    apres c'est a vous de chercher sur le net un fichier de reboot pour redemarer votre dreambox tous les jours a 3h00 par exemple


    ou alors de faire un script pour vider votre log toutes les heures pour ceux qui utlise le log par exemple
    les action sont multiple

    je vous deconseille de lancer un script de surveillance toutes les minutes mais plutot toutes les 10 voir 20 minutes

    pour tester si le script de surveillance emu et bien fonctionnelle mettez votre binaire oscam ou cccam en attribut 644 et faite un shoutdown sur le webinfo oscam

    et oscam devrais ne pas se relancer

    remettre attribut 755 sur votre binaire et ne faites rien dautre attendez et regarder si votre oscam se relance tous seul
    pour cccam une fois mis en 644 redemarer votre dreambox une fois redemarer verifier que votre cccam n'est pas lancer
    remettre en attribut 755 et attendez que votre cccam se lance tous seul
    pour les essai lancer le crond pour q'il execute les tache demander toutes les minutes afin de voir que tous est OK et pour ne pas attendre 10 minutes
    si tous est bon alors vous pouvez modifier votre cron pour q'il execute les tache au minutes voulu


    J'ajouté un fichier reboot a 4h15 tous les jour
    Fichiers joints Fichiers joints
    Dernière édition par costa69; 31-01-2013 à 04:55

  2. Merci audi RS4 disent merci

  3. #2
    DZSatien Habitué Avatar de nno51
    Inscrit
    Jul 2010
    Lieu
    Bruxelles
    Messages
    270
    Remerciement / J'aime
    Bon travail Consta

    Aurais-tu un tuto pour la E2 pour VU+
    Dernière édition par nno51; 31-01-2013 à 09:49
    Vu+ Duo -hd 2T - Black Hole 2.0.3 + CCCam 2.1.4 avec cccam.prio
    IPhone 3GS et ipad 2

  4. #3
    DZSatien Motivé Avatar de costa69
    Inscrit
    Aug 2010
    Lieu
    france
    Âge
    39
    Messages
    466
    Récepteur
    dreambox
    TV
    condor
    Remerciement / J'aime
    <div class="bbcode_container">
    Citation Envoyé par nno51 Voir le message
    Bon travail Consta

    Aurais-tu un tuto pour la E2 pour VU+
    non jai pas mais le principe dois etre le meme

  • Merci sami_35 disent merci
  • #4
    Nouveau Avatar de Avenches
    Inscrit
    Jan 2011
    Lieu
    Avenches
    Messages
    33
    Récepteur
    Dreambox
    TV
    Meo
    Remerciement / J'aime
    Merci Bravo costa 73s

  • #5
    DZSatien Habitué
    Inscrit
    Jan 2010
    Messages
    185
    Récepteur
    vuplus
    TV
    samsung
    Remerciement / J'aime
    un grand boulot

  • Sujets similaires

    1. tuto pour installer oscam emu tntsat sans carte pour E1 et E2 fichier fourni
      Par costa69 dans le forum Oscam Soft, Tuto ,Config
      Réponses: 30
      Dernier message: 05-05-2013, 11:28
    2. installation CRON sur image newnigma2 3.2.2
      Par squall39 dans le forum Entraide E2
      Réponses: 4
      Dernier message: 26-08-2012, 15:12
    3. Réponses: 32
      Dernier message: 12-04-2012, 11:25
    4. autre tuto en image (merci à je ne sais qui)
      Par dudu59 dans le forum Discussions autour du satellite
      Réponses: 2
      Dernier message: 14-11-2007, 20:46

    Règles des messages

    • Vous ne pouvez pas créer de sujets
    • Vous ne pouvez pas répondre aux sujets
    • Vous ne pouvez pas importer de fichiers joints
    • Vous ne pouvez pas modifier vos messages
    •  
    Nous contacter | DZSat | Archives | Haut de page